Description
Entrance Lobby - An external uPVC door with an opaque glazed panel gives access to the entrance lobby. This is the perfect place for storing shoes and coats and access can be gained to the living room.
Living Room - This good sized reception room is positioned at the front of the property. It has a fire surround with a matching inlay and hearth, home to a coal effect living flame gas fire. There is coving to the ceiling, a uPVC window, plenty of space for furniture, coving to the ceiling and a radiator. An internal door leads to the kitchen.
Kitchen - The kitchen is positioned at the rear of the property and has wall cupboards, base units, working surfaces with brick-style splashbacks and a stainless steel sink. It has a four-ring gas hob with a pull-out filter hood and a built-in fan oven. There is space for freestanding appliances, floor tiling, a uPVC stable-style rear door, a uPVC window and a radiator. Access can be gained to the first floor and the cellar.
Cellar - This handy storage space houses the Ideal Instinct 2 boiler for the central heating system. There is space for additional kitchen appliances and a radiator.
First Floor Landing - From the kitchen, a staircase rises to the first floor landing where there is access to the loft.
Bedroom One - This large double bedroom is positioned at the front of the property with mirror-fronted wardrobes and plenty of space for further furniture. It has a uPVC window and a radiator.
Bedroom Two - This double bedroom is positioned at the rear of the property with a uPVC window and a radiator.
Bathroom - The bathroom has a three-piece suite comprising a panelled bath with a shower attachment from the mixer tap, a wash hand basin with storage cupboards below and a low-level WC. There is tiling to the walls, an upright chrome ladder-style radiator and a uPVC window.
External Details - At the front of the property is a perimeter wall and a wide flagged pathway leads to the entrance door. On the right hand side of the pathway is a gravelled garden designed for ease of maintenance. The rear garden is enclosed with a paved seating area and an adjoining gravelled area. There is a timber shed and perimeter fencing.
